"who have a 1099 Misc or NEC of a fairly minimal amount and no expenses"
These informational forms are only required in certain circumstances, but people can have made more money than this in the endeavor. You could make a million $ from being a notary and would never get a 1099-NEC for the service. It still is reported.
1099-Misc is for different reason than 1099-NEC. NEC would be Schedule C, but MISC might be royalties or rent. Are you trying to enter Rent as subject to Self-employment tax?
